
The Workshop is a weekly pop-up in downtown Ester that highlights Alaskan artists and craftspeople.
Open every weekend throughout the summer, The Workshop offers artists a space to demonstrate their craft & showcase their work. It's a place where anyone can come enjoy & support our vibrant Fairbanks arts community!

visit.
The Workshop is open seasonally from late May through August at the historic Ester Gold Camp. Located in the old hot dog building, next to the Malemute Saloon and Flossie & Mays Coffee Shop: 3660 Main Street, Fairbanks, AK 99709
2026 Season: May 22 - August 30
Fridays | 5:30-8:30pm
Saturdays | 10:30am-6:30pm
Sundays | 10:30am-2:30pm
*Some artists choose to have extended hours. Please see individual events below for the most accurate hours!
